Topics Covered

  1. Linear Algebra Basics: Covers vector spaces, matrices, and linear transformations essential for numerical methods.: Eigenvalue Problems: Focuses on solving eigenvalue problems and their applications in functional equations.
  2. Iterative Methods: Explores iterative techniques for solving systems of linear and nonlinear equations.: Approximation Theory: Discusses polynomial and spline approximations, and their role in numerical solutions.
  3. Numerical Integration: Covers various numerical integration techniques and their accuracy.: Differential Equations: Introduces numerical methods for solving ordinary and partial differential equations.
